Metal Inert Gas (MIG) welding is a globally adopted technique for joining metal parts by melting the metal through an electric arc. This process entails continuously feeding a solid wire electrode through a welding gun while incorporating a shielding gas, usually a combination of argon and carbon dioxide.   1. What are the main duties of a MIG welder?

The main duty of a MIG welder is to firmly fuse metal components together using Metal Inert Gas (MIG) welding processes. This entails using welding equipment and monitoring the welds’ structural integrity.

  1. Which sectors commonly use MIG welders?

Several industries, including construction, automobile manufacture, shipbuilding, aerospace, and metal fabrication, have a high need for MIG welders.

  1. What credentials are necessary to work as a MIG welder?

Typically, you require a high school diploma or its equivalent to work as a MIG welder. Gaining welding qualifications can improve work opportunities, and vocational or technical training in welding is frequently recommended.

  1. Are there particular qualifications required for MIG welding positions?

Yes, MIG welders should be proficient in utilizing welding equipment. They should have abilities like precision welding, reading blueprints, understanding of welding safety procedures, and others.

  1. Does MIG welding provide prospects for job advancement?

Yes, skilled MIG welders can progress to positions as welding inspectors or supervisors. Additionally, advanced training and certifications can lead to opportunities in specialized welding positions.
